Man Struck And Killed By Tractor Trailer At Boston Hospital
BOSTON (CBS) - A hospital visitor was struck and killed by a tractor trailer at a Brighton hospital.
The accident happened around 1:30 p.m. Monday near a loading dock at St. Elizabeth's Medical Center.

Boston Police tell WBZ, the truck was backing up when it hit the 80-year-old man.
The tractor trailer is owned by Angelica, a healthcare linen service company with a location in Somerville.
A spokesperson from Angelica said a manager was at the scene.
Police have not released the identity of the victim.
No charges or citations have been issued.
